BBC Arena, Indoor sports arena in Schaffhausen, Switzerland.
BBC Arena is an indoor sports facility in Schaffhausen with a spacious main hall, high ceilings, and modern sports flooring suitable for multiple disciplines. The building provides proper conditions for handball, volleyball, and other indoor sports.
BBC Arena was built as a dedicated sports facility for handball in Schaffhausen, significantly improving the city's sports infrastructure. This allowed the town to host professional competitions at a higher level.
This facility serves as the home ground for Kadetten Schaffhausen, a handball club competing in national league matches. Supporters regularly gather here to watch and cheer for the local team during competitions.
The facility is open during daytime and evening hours on most days, with parking available for visitors. It is helpful to check exact opening times before visiting, as they may vary depending on scheduled events.
Starting in 2025, the arena will introduce a QR code system for entrance and lighting control, bringing digital technology into daily operations. This upgrade makes it one of the more technologically advanced sports facilities in the region.
